WebApr 17, 2024 · If a high-temperature warewashing machine is used to sanitize cleaned dishes, the final sanitizing rinse must be at least 180oF (82oC). For stationary rack, single temperature machines, it must be at least 165oF (74oC). How is hot water used to sanitize dishes? An acceptable method of hot water sanitizing is by utilizing the three …

WebRefer to the equipment's manual or call the manufacturer for answers to your questions. For mechanical dishware washing equipment operated by food handlers, the Food and Drug Administration's (FDA) recommends to use temperatures that range from 165°F (73.9°C) to 180 °F (82.2°C).
